All Time Low have announced their next album will be out very, very soon, and we couldn't be happier.
Wake Up, Sunshine will be out on April 3rd, and is a follow-up to 2017's Last Young Renegade.
READ MORE: All Time Low Return With First Song Of Next Era, 'Some Kind Of Disaster'
The band has been teasing the album's announcement since the start of the year, posting a series of cryptic teasers to social media.
Now, we've finally got confirmation that they were teasing a new album, and vocalist Alex Gaskarth says the record is a return to the band's roots.
"We got back to how we started. It had been a long time since the four of us made a record under one roof. That became a central theme. We’ve been a band for 17 years. Everybody brought something to the table. A lot of what you’re hearing came from those magic moments together.”
